Cricket Microservices Framework for Java.
Building microservices
Add dependency to your pom.xml
<dependency>
<groupId>org.cricketmsf</groupId>
<artifactId>cricket</artifactId>
<version>2.0.0-rc36</version>
</dependency>

Development
Clone repository
$ git clone https://github.com/gskorupa/cricket.git
Build
$ mvn package
